Output ef757d004c3ef907ded245d32ff0b8c2afc9c3323c53f3d5c794f64d7be9a399:1

value
43908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ca26343721ed6096f030d48ac8e7ff8d83b109 OP_EQUAL
address
2N2Ls3rGJpJiGWwKf8moTwwokTpqqXVpbYp
transaction
ef757d004c3ef907ded245d32ff0b8c2afc9c3323c53f3d5c794f64d7be9a399